France - Sold Production of Cans, of Iron or Steel, to Be Closed by Soldering or Crimping, of a Capacity Less than 50 L

Since 2014, France Sold Production of Cans, of Iron or Steel, to Be Closed by Soldering or Crimping, of a Capacity Less than 50 L fell by 13.5% year on year. In 2019, the country was ranked number 4 comparing other countries in Sold Production of Cans, of Iron or Steel, to Be Closed by Soldering or Crimping, of a Capacity Less than 50 L with €437,409,579.46. France is overtaken by Italy, which was ranked number 3 at €532,257,227.69 and is followed by Netherlands at €401,677,163.71. Germany lead the ranking with €715,508,961.64 in 2019, a fall of 1.9% versus 2018. Germany recorded the best 5 years average growth at +6.4% per year, while Romania recorded the worst performance at -40.3% per year.
